Abstract The purpose of my experiment is to see which mask material is best at preventing the spread of bacteria. Whichever mask has the most bacteria is safest, because it captures most of the bacteria. The mask with the least amount of bacteria is the least safe, which means it would let the most bacteria pass through the mask. I will test the masks over 2, 4, and 7-hour time periods, with three participants per time period, to see how the amount of time the mask is worn impacts the number of bacteria they capture.
